Transaction 987865933dd9dec18c945b5a44e6000d3657eae1073cbb606a5705c7e99bbd3e

2 Input
2 Outputs
  • 987865933dd9dec18c945b5a44e6000d3657eae1073cbb606a5705c7e99bbd3e:0
  • value  50000000
    address  164tMANBPGWyvqqotr8u4iqGkxFzswmMTM
  • 987865933dd9dec18c945b5a44e6000d3657eae1073cbb606a5705c7e99bbd3e:1
  • value  39094945
    address  38aHa2K5BdY8WdiF11HYBSYkyKAT1J7mm3